Did you know?

WebBluebell woods are breathtaking to visit, but bluebells are sensitive plants and trampling can really leave its mark. Bluebell bulbs are easily damaged by trampling so they can’t produce enough energy to flower and reproduce in subsequent years. Areas of high footfall can even cause entire colonies to die out. Supplied "in the green" whilst growing and individually packed. 100 English Bluebells in the green (Scilla Non-scripta) 100 Snowdrops in the green (Single - Galanthus Nivalis) 100 Wild … WebMar 12, 2024 · Establish bare-root rhizomes in early spring or fall. If planting in the spring, stratify or cool the rhizome in the refrigerator for at least 60 days. This plant requires moisture and gradually warming soil temperatures to spur its growth. Virginia bluebells prefers a shady spot that gets moderate filtered sunlight.
